Monthly plans remain available only for legacy accounts through renewal. Sales leads should update quoting templates and brief their teams by the 15th. Expect some pushback from smaller accounts; the discount ladder gives you room to negotiate. Revenue recognition changes are handled by finance—no action needed on your end. Commission adjustments take effect with the new cycle. The rationale behind this timing is outlined in the confidential note below.

internal memo for yahag-hahig: Belwynix Group plans to lower the Silir list price by 62 percent in May.

# Quillsort Environments

Quillsort's report builder runs in dev, staging, and prod. Plugin authors should note that sort stability differs: dev uses an unstable in-memory sort for speed, while staging and prod guarantee stable ordering on tie-broken columns. Always validate plugin output against staging before release, since row order in dev is not reproducible. The staging environment runs with the values below.

deployment values, bahop-yadug:
[caswyn]
port = 8443
region = east-4
host = caswyn.lumicworks.internal
timeout_ms = 5000
retries = 8

Q: Do the Fernwick Java and Swift SDKs have feature parity for release 2.8? A: Mostly. Offline caching and batch uploads match, but the Swift SDK still lacks delta sync, slated for 2.9. Do not announce parity in release notes yet. The current parity matrix is maintained on the page below.

dashboard of yahig-kagaf = https://jira.orvexgrid.local/spaces/board/display/pages/repo/board/run/2e5f7144ef5e0c8772d510ac

## Break-Glass: Dispatch Heuristic Overrides

If the Routewell driver-assignment heuristic begins misrouting and the config service is unavailable, the release manager may enable manual override mode from the fallback host. Overrides persist until the next deploy, so log the change in the release channel. The fallback host accepts one unlock attempt using the recovery passphrase below.

vault phrase of tajef-tafog = istox-sorax-zorox-casok-holox-kelix-weneth-drueth-casion